In this course, students demonstrate the depth and breadth of their technical competencies by researching and writing an electrical technology report consistent with ASET guidelines. Students must select a project topic that extends beyond the scope of the program curriculum, and that requires them to research and analyze technical information, as well as to design, troubleshoot, construct or test electrical equipment or systems. Students develop project management skills by producing a project proposal and an interim progress report. They also develop their oral presentation abilities by presenting and defending their work in front of their instructors and peers.
